VS2010 projects and VS2008

I just tried to open a c# project created in vs2012, .net4 with vs2008.

After changing the target framework to 3.5 everything was fine...until I tried to use some LINQ.
I was told me to add a reference to 'System.Data.LINQ'. So I tried to add a new reference but ... none of the 3.5 references were available (only 1.*, 2.* and 4.*).

Solution:
- Close your solution.
- Navigate to the solutions directory and delete the *.suo file.
- Open your solution.

Now, all the references of the .net versions (in fact the 3.5 ones) should be available again.

Edit: adding a 'using System.Linq' makes it complete
